my tomatoes look very much like pictures of what are called Tomato burn injury (and it has been searingly hot lately). Any idea if the tomatoes are still edible?

Anton

That's what I would say it was.  It is the tomato version of serious sunburn.

They are edible, but will be mushy where the damage is.  You could cut those bits off and make tomato sauce with the rest, but use them up fast.  They will start to go mouldy where the skin is affected.
